    A theory of semiregenerative phenomena was developed earlier by the author [A celebration of applied probability, J. Appl. Probab., Spec. Vol. 25A, 257-274 (1988; Zbl 0664.60115)]. This phenomenon is a generalization of Feller's recurrent event in discrete time and Kingman's regenerative phenomenon in continuous time. A survey of the results obtained by the author and his collaborators is presented. These include the connection between a semiregenerative set (the points at which the semiregenerative phenomenon occurs) and the range of a Markov subordinator with a unit drift, the fluctuation behaviour of nondegenerate Markov random walk (MRW) and a Wiener-Hopf factorization of the MRW [see the author, \textit{L. C. Tang} and \textit{Y. Zhu}, J. Math. Phys. Sci. 25, No. 5/6, 635-663 (1991; Zbl 0790.60059)].
